Biography

Corné Hanssen is an Assistant Professor at Utrecht University, focusing on the fields of Arabic and Berber Studies. His expertise includes the study of Islam, specifically Shia Islam. He has actively engaged in academic teaching and research, contributing to the understanding of Arabic language and culture. His work on Islamic studies emphasizes the historical and contemporary significance of Shia practices and beliefs. Hanssen is involved in various scholarly activities, including publications and academic presentations, aimed at enhancing knowledge in his areas of specialization.
